Nope, I don't really know much about her background. Her mom was an anery who originally came from Kathy, and was very contrasty -- black and gray. Almost no yellow at all. I don't have a clue where her dad originated from. He was one of those "looks like an anery as a hatchling but looks like a ghost as an adult" kind of corns. He had a ton of yellow, from his nose to his tail. I thought he WAS a ghost until I bred him back to his daughter last year, and got ONE ghost out of the clutch (a motley ghost at that!).

Here are photos of the parents... It amazes me that these two snakes produced such nice looking offspring. I've never really liked the look of the mom (don't like the zigzag), but I like her babies!
